Thursday 22 April 2010
Don Broco + Scholars + Accidents by Design + Up Down Strange
don broco.jpg
Don Broco is a post hard core / pop the band that have been on the road touring with Enter Shikari, as well as playing Download festival, Relentless Boardmasters festival and Underage festival. Scholars grew up listening to bands like Braid, Hundred Reasons, Death Cab for Cutie and Tears for Fears. ‘Throat shredding vocals and strong riffs setting them up as the descendants of Hell Is For Heroes and Hundred Reasons... They may be onto a very good thing’ Kerrang!
Buy tickets onlineAdmission: £3 adv /£4 otd
